Output 3eff4048579390c73d44acc8b9630351f1b35f651404a68c91f812df52a801ba:1

value
5429600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 953a434dd14adc333c109e0ebea32c7ad86937c9 OP_EQUALVERIFY OP_CHECKSIG
address
1Ec3Um74K8Knvriv4uSqHoeindBEmXsnpR
transaction
3eff4048579390c73d44acc8b9630351f1b35f651404a68c91f812df52a801ba
spent
true